BAKED CHIPOTLE CHICKEN FLAUTAS



Baked Chipotle Chicken Flautas image

Provided by Food Network

Time 44m

Yield 5 Serv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 (10) oz can of reduced fat and sodium cream of chicken soup
1/3 cup reduced fat sour cream
1 (4) oz can of diced green chile peppers, undrained
1 teaspoon ground chipotle pepper
1/2 teaspoon of 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on of ground coriander
2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
2 teaspoons canola oil mixed with 1/2 teaspoon of ground chipotle pepper
10 Mission® Small/Fajita Flour Tortillas
2 cups diced cooked chicken breast meat

Steps:

  • 1.Preheat the oven to 450°F 2.Mix all above ingredients (except flour tortillas, canola oil, and ground chipotle pepper) in a medium size saucepan. Heat over medium heat until hot. Remove from heat. 3.Place about 3 tablespoons of the chicken filling along the edge of a tortilla. Roll the tortilla up more tight than loose. Put a toothpick through the middle of the flauta to hold in place. Place on a sprayed large baking sheet. Repeat with the remaining tortillas. 4.In a small bowl mix together the canola oil and ground chipotle pepper. 5.Lightly brush the flautas with the oil mixture. Bake until golden brown, about 15 minutes. Cool. 6.Remove toothpicks, slice each flautas on the diagonal. Transfer on your favorite fiesta platter, sprinkle with chopped fresh cilantro, serve with low fat sour cream and salsa.

BAKED CHIPOTLE CHICKEN FLAUTAS



Baked Chipotle Chicken Flautas image

Spicy cooked chicken in a creamy sauce is rolled into tortillas, baked until golden brown, then served with sour cream, salsa, and cilantro.

Provided by Mission Foods

Time 44m

Yield 5

Number Of Ingredients 12

10 Mission® Small/Fajita Flour Tortillas
2 cups diced cooked chicken breast meat
1 (10.75 ounce) can reduced fat and sodium cream of chicken soup
1 (4 ounce) can diced green chile peppers, undrained
1 teaspoon ground dried chili pepper
½ teaspoon ground cumin
½ teaspoon ground coriander
2 tablespoons canola oil
½ teaspoon ground chipotle pepper
2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
⅓ cup reduced-fat sour cream
Prepared salsa

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F.
  • Mix together chicken, cream of chicken soup, diced green chile peppers, 1 tsp. chipotle powder, cumin, and coriander in a medium size saucepan. Heat over medium heat until hot. Remove from heat.
  • Place about 3 tablespoons of the chicken filling along the edge of a tortilla. Roll the tortilla up more tight than loose. Put a toothpick through the middle of the flauta to hold in place. Place on a sprayed large baking sheet. Repeat with the remaining tortillas.
  • In a small bowl mix together the canola oil and remaining ground chipotle pepper.
  • Lightly brush the flautas with the oil mixture. Bake until golden brown, about 15 minutes. Cool.
  • Remove toothpicks, slice each flautas on the diagonal. Transfer on your favorite fiesta platter, sprinkle with chopped fresh cilantro, serve with low fat sour cream and salsa.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 723.6 calories, Carbohydrate 36.3 g, Cholesterol 217 mg, Fat 37.5 g, Fiber 2.5 g, Protein 38.6 g, SaturatedFat 7.2 g, Sodium 2163.1 mg, Sugar 0.8 g
